PokerStars Zoom, Hold'em No Limit - $0.01/$0.02 - 6 players
Hand delivered by Upswing Poker
UTG: $2.38 (119 bb)
MP: $4.12 (206 bb)
CO: $2.05 (103 bb)
BU: $2.11 (106 bb)
SB (Hero): $2.15 (108 bb)
BB: $2.03 (102 bb)
Pre-Flop: ($0.03) Hero is SB with J♣ J♦
UTG raises to $0.05, 3 players fold, Hero 3-bets to $0.18, 1 fold, UTG calls $0.13
Flop: ($0.38) 9♣ 5♠ J♥ (2 players)
Hero checks, UTG checks
Turn: ($0.38) 3♠ (2 players)
Hero bets $0.32, UTG calls $0.32
River: ($1.02) A♦ (2 players)
Hero bets $1.65 (all-in), UTG folds
Preflop
I think 3-betting JJ vs UTG open is correct because it narrows his range. If you think differently, please let me know.
Flop
I hit a set on a dry board. I expect him to call my c-bet only with QQ so I check.
I assume he would 4bet KK+ preflop so I put him on this range: AK, TT-QQ, AQs (maybe)
Turn
doesn't change anything and I bet for value.
River
brings an Ace and I expect him to have a lot of aces so I decide to shove for maximum value.
I'm confused about his play-calling the big bet on the turn and folding the river.
What do you think about my play and what would you do on the river.
Is better to bet small to induce a bluff or to get a call from TT?
